Regional Pool & Tennis Centre and Active Living Centre

Assisting the Aquatics Coordinator in the implementation of our weekly Learn to Swim programme, and delivery and evaluation of swimming lessons following the Learn to Swim Wales programme.

Hours, Pay and Benefits

We have various shifts available so can create part time contracts around your availability. There will also be opportunities to pick up additional shifts as absence cover when available.

Key Experiences and Qualifications

  • Practical experience of delivering swim lessons to children, young people and/or adults in a leisure environment
  • Organising, planning, and delivering structured swimming sessions whilst adapting to varying needs, abilities, and ages
  • Working with children, young people, and adults from varying backgrounds and specific needs requirements

Role Requirements

  • Teach swimming lessons as part of our Integrated Swimming Programme, following the Learn to Swim Wales teaching framework
  • Prepare, implement, and evaluate schemes of work to ensure continual development of all participants
  • Maintain accurate records of all participants, including attendance, attainment, and progress
  • Ensure that all lesson plans and records of achievement are accurately recorded, maintained, and distributed as required
  • Promote swimming as a sport; helping provide links to all relevant aquatic clubs to all participants of the Learn to Swim programme (and their parent/guardian for children and young people)
  • Responsibility for the safe preparation of facilities and equipment as required by the Learn to Swim programme and checking the set-up of facilities and equipment undertaken by Recreation Assistants
  • Ensure compliance with all relevant statutory legal requirements, and particularly the Health & Safety at Work Act (1974) and Child Protection Act
  • willingness to assist in the organising and delivery of swimming galas and events
  • Undertaking appropriate training as and when required, as part of the Swimming Development Continual Development Programme
  • Delivery of excellent customer service to ensure a positive experience for all participants
  • Attendance at swimming teachers’ forums and/or meetings as and when requested
  • To undertake any other duties as may be required in line with the role as requested by the Aquatics Coordinator, Head Swimming Coach or Head of Business Development
